Lefebvre (1991) conceptualized social space as a concrete universal of three terms (spatial practice, representations of space, and spaces of representations), of three levels (perceived, conceived, lived) and of three forms (absolute, historical, abstract). A key feature of abstract space is its mediated char- acter, and Latona is engaged in active media- tion on multi-levels, interpenetrating natural space with social space.
In subjecting this Tasmanian wilderness experience to close scrutiny there are four major spatial constructs to contend with – the bio-geological space of the wilderness itself and the way it is interpreted through the medium of guides; the physical spaceof archi- tectural forms which provide shelter (the built environment) as transient humans navigate the ancient bio-geological space; the social space of visitors and guides engaged in small group relationships; and the mental or psychological spacesthat visitors construct from the thoughts that crowd in upon them as they physically tra- verse the other three spaces. The Nature of the Trek Through Nature The wilderness experiences of the Overland Track and the Bay of Fires are soundly based in the principles of ecologically sustainable tourism, and Latona’s guided tours are designed to foster in his guests love and stew- ardship of the Tasmanian wilderness and all wild, natural places. The company’s philosophy of respect for place is demonstrated through minimal-impact track and hut practices. The
Impermanence in Wilderness: Tasmania 123
huts are designed to be ecologically sustainable, with self-contained, non-polluting services and waste management practices. Both trails are seasonal, operated for only 6 months of the year. The Overland Track can experience heavy snowfalls even in summer. It is impassable for most of the winter when the ‘roaring forties’
hold the highlands in their icy, blustery grip.
The Bay of Fires trail experiences inclement weather in winter also. Trekkers are restricted to a maximum of ten in any one group, and they are accompanied at all times by two guides.
Depending upon the terrain, 9–12 km is the average length of each day’s walk. Stops are frequent and in fine weather side trips to addi- tional points of interest (such as scaling Tasmania’s highest peak, Mt Ossa) can be undertaken. The guides share their knowledge of the flora, fauna, geology and history of the parks, and their interpretation is presented in the context of ecological sustainability.
Guests must carry their own backpacks, complete with changes of clothes, cold/wet weather protective clothing in case of sudden temperature changes, their own toiletries and towel (but not soap: the lodges are provided with a phosphorus-free, biodegradable liquid soap for ablutions); a groundsheet and sleeping bag. This latter is a safety requirement: with guides carrying a tent between huts, walkers
would be safe if they were required to make an emergency camp. Laundry is minimized by making guests responsible for their own bed- ding. No laundry is done on-site. Accommo- dation is twin-share in unheated bedrooms (thus saving fuel and energy consumption), in isolated austere huts, along the lines of a monastery rather than a luxury hotel (the design features are detailed below). The cuisine is a feature of the trek; fresh bread is baked by the guides for breakfast each morning, supple- mented with cereals and fresh fruit. Three- course meals served with Tasmanian fine wines are standard evening meals (food is flown in by helicopter on a regular basis).
Operational aspects cover conservation of fuel and energy; recycling; composting toilets that have no drainage, thus limiting pollution (wastes are flown out by helicopter); waste min- imization, e.g. by using bulk sugar, coffee and similar foods rather than individual packets, and biodegradable products wherever possible; and water conservation – in short many features which limit the possible adverse impacts of the operations on the fragile environments and which enhance in practical ways the principles of sustainability. All grey water is treated (kitchen and bathroom systems are separated, grease arresters and biological filters are used) before disposal in clean form to absorption trenches.

The philosophical approach to sustainabil- ity is perhaps most clearly apparent in the con- servation of water. Rainwater is collected off the roof in two relatively small tanks and guests are advised that supply is limited and that water must be used sparingly. There is no bath.
Showers are linked to a 10-litre container which each guest must fill by hand-pump prior to taking a shower. The water is then gravity- fed through a small gas heater and a low- pressure shower rose and this allows for a 2-minute shower per person per day.
Handbasins are small and supplied with cold water only. No water is used for irrigation, land- scaping, toilets or laundry, although guests can handwash one or two items per day in the cold- water basins using the biodegradable soap. For the privilege of carrying their own gear, hand- pumping their own 2-minute shower and sleep- ing in their own unwashed bedding in unheated bedrooms in un-insulated isolated, imperma- nent huts without electricity, television, tele- phones, hair dryers or any other electronic convenience, guests pay up to US$300 per day.

Bio-geological space
The Tasmanian Wilderness World Heritage Area is one of the largest nature reserves in Australia, incorporating about 20% of the land area of the island of Tasmania, and covering 1.38 million ha. The boundaries of the conser- vation area extend from sea level (the wild and isolated south-west coast of Tasmania whose beaches are pounded by surf driven by the roar- ing forties, to Tasmania’s highest peaks (Mt Ossa is 1617 m or 4945 ft). Landscapes include extensive glaciated valleys, deep river gorges, moorlands and heathlands, swamps and wetlands, and some of the most extensive tracts of cool temperate rainforests in the world. The area was inscribed on the World Heritage List in 1982, and extended in 1989, because of its outstanding natural features which include fragile alpine habitats, extensive rivers and cave systems, rare and endemic plants and animals, and old-growth remnant forests whose antecedents date back to the ancient mega-continent of Gondwanaland. Its isolation and rugged terrain has allowed several animals that are either extinct or threatened on the mainland of Australia to thrive, such as the carnivorous marsupials, the Tasmanian devil, and the spotted-tailed and eastern quolls.
Platypus and echidna are abundant. Bird species number more than 180 and include the endemic green rosella and the rare orange-bel- lied parrot. Other noteworthy fauna include the moss froglet and the Tasmanian tree frog, the Tasmanian cave spider, and the burrowing crayfish. Rocks from every geological period are represented in the area and water-soluble
layers of dolomite and limestone have resulted in the formation of some of the deepest and longest cave systems in Australia (http://www.
dpiwe.tas.gov.au/inter.nsf/).
Located within the WHA is the Overland Track, 80 km long, which traverses Cradle Mountain–Lake St Clair National Park, a reserve of 161,000 ha making up the north- ernmost section of the Wilderness reserve. In the north is a high treeless plateau with deep glacial lakes and tarns, and the ridge on which Cradle Mountain rises to 1525 m (4758 ft).
Tasmania’s highest mountain, Mt Ossa can be climbed from the central section of the park, an area dominated by alpine heathland. The track then follows the Mersey River valley before climbing to Du Cane Gap and descending along the Narcissus River to the northern shores of Lake St Clair, the deepest lake in Australia at 215 m (670 ft). It is this 6-day walk which constitutes the basis for Latona’s alpine wilderness experience (Cradle Huts) (http://
www.cradlehuts.com.au/hutfrme.html).
The Bay of Fires wilderness trek, by con- trast, is a coastal experience which takes the traveller along the beaches, fringing sand dunes, wetlands and eucalyptus forests of Mount William National Park. The park is located in the north-east of Tasmania and the bay is near the southern boundary of the park.
It was named by the French explorer, Captain Tobias Furneaux, in 1773. Sailing along the coast he saw a string of Aborigines’ fires along the beaches. At that time the whole north-east coast of Tasmania was well populated and the nomadic Aborigines traditionally moved to the coast during winter to feast on shellfish, shear- waters (mutton birds) and seals. Numerous Aboriginal middens are evident along the beaches and sandhills of the Park. Middens are of particular archaeological interest because they are evidence of ancient Aboriginal camps.
They consist largely of huge piles of shells, interspersed with the bones of birds and ani- mals and occasional flints, spearheads, etc., many of the remains blackened after having been roasted on open fires (Berndt and Berndt, 1964).
While the park does not have world her- itage status, it is rich in flora and fauna. It is the main sanctuary for the Forester kangaroo, and has abundant populations of wallabies, wom-

Geologically the park is dominated by granite dating back 380 million years. Huge granite boulders line many of the beaches and are covered in bright orange lichen. Over mil- lennia granite quartz has weathered and disin- tegrated to form glistening white sand, and this combined with the huge orange-coloured boul- ders make the beaches scenically some of the most attractive in Australia (http://www.

Physical space: architecture applied to wilderness
Most architects design for permanence, with the buildings they construct intended to stand as statements of their creativity and as endur- ing monuments to their vision. This is of course an ancient human trait, with the pyramids of Egypt, the Taj Mahal of India and the Great Wall of China standing as mute testimony over millennia to their designers’ genius. It is evident in the resorts and hotels that the tourism indus- try has constructed globally, whether it be the Peninsula Hotel in Hong Kong, the Hideaway Resort in Tahiti, or the Club Med villas in Mauritius. Mountain summits, cliff tops and similar vantage points are favoured by thou- sands of resorts around the world.
But Ken Latona’s approach is markedly different. The accommodation space that visi- tors occupy during their encounter with Tasmania’s alpine and coastal wilderness is designed to meld into the landscape. The lodges do not dominate the skyline but are hidden in folds in the hills, carefully sited in order to be invisible from surrounding vantage points so that only pristine countryside may be seen. They ‘tread lightly’ upon the ancient land.
They required no excavation, are lightweight, easy to dismantle and take away so that within 12 months of their going the footprint of the space they occupied would again be taken over
by the surrounding bush. They provide a degree of comfort yet are impermanent. They provide simultaneously shelter from the ele- ments yet exposure to the elements. They are there only to provide a safe haven for the walk- ers rather than a means of isolating guests in luxurious artificiality divorced from the natural environment. There is a deliberate blurring between the inside and the outside: windows have no blinds or curtains so that the guest is in touch with the moon and the stars in the night sky and the sun at dawn. Cradle Huts
For the five Cradle Mountain cabins constructed along the Overland Track the planning and con- struction amongst complex land forms posed an exacting challenge. An individual environmental impact assessment was undertaken for each hut site before development was approved. The evaluation process took 3 years and approval was granted by the Tasmanian Ministerial Council for the World Heritage Area (quoted in http://www.cradlehuts.com.au/hutfrme.html).
The fragility of the varied alpine environments made it imperative to use low-impact construc- tion techniques. Soil types varied from site to site, including glacial moraine ridges composed of peat whose slow decomposition in high alti- tudes means that the peat can be up to 1000 years old. Other sites had a high water table so that any excavation or in-ground con- struction could impede groundwater flows. Yet others had mature trees besides other vegetation that dictated the exact siting of a hut. Standard practice in the southern hemisphere is for build- ings to face north or north-east for best passive thermal qualities but in this case the environ- mental impact assessment weighted natural ele- ments over human comfort, and only two of the five lodges face north (http://twinshare.crc- tourism.com.au/CaseStudies/).
